DESCRIPTION
VSMY1850 is an infrared, 850 nm emitting diode based on
GaAlAs surface emitter chip technology with high radiant
intensity, high optical power and high speed, molded in
clear, untinted 0805 plastic package for surface mounting
(SMD).
FEATURES
• Package type: surface mount
• Package form: 0805
• Dimensions (L x W x H in mm): 2 x 1.25 x 0.85
• Peak wavelength: λp = 850 nm
• High reliability
• High radiant power
• High radiant intensity
• High speed
• Angle of half sensitivity: ϕ = ± 60°
• Suitable for high pulse current operation
• 0805 standard surface-mountable package
• Floor life: 168 h, MSL 3, acc. J-STD-020
• Lead (Pb)-free reflow soldering
• Compliant to RoHS Directive 2002/95/EC and in
accordance to WEEE 2002/96/EC
APPLICATIONS
• IrDA compatible data transmission
• Miniature light barrier
• Photointerrupters
• Optical switch
• Emitter source for proximity sensors
• IR touch panels
• IR Flash
• IR illumination
• 3D TV
